Definition of Cosmetology

Taftville CT makeup school studentCosmetology is an occupation that is all about making the human body look more attractive through the use of cosmetics. So of course it makes sense that many cosmetology schools are referred to as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the term cosmetics, but really a cosmetic can be almost anything that enhances the appearance of a person’s skin, hair or nails. In order to work as a cosmetologist, almost all states require that you undergo some type of specialized training and then be licensed. Once you are licensed, the work environments include not only Taftville CT beauty salons and barber shops, but also such venues as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, once they have acquired experience and a clientele, open their own shops or salons. Others will begin seeing customers either in their own residences or will go to the client’s home, or both. Cosmetology college graduates have many professional names and work in a wide range of specializations including:

  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Estheticians
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As already stated, in the majority of states practicing cosmetologists must be licensed. In certain states there is an exemption. Only those conducting more skilled services, such as h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Others working in cosmetology and less skilled, including shampooers, are not required to be licensed in those states.

Cosmetology Degrees

Taftville CT hair design student cutting hairThere are essentially two avenues offered to get cosmetology training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) course, or you can work toward an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s usually require 12 to 18 months to complete, while an Associate’s degree ordinarily tak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be trained in each of the main areas of cosmetology. Briefer programs are offered if you wish to concentrate on just one area, for example hair coloring. A degree program will also probably include management and marketing training so that graduates are better prepared to manage a salon or other Taftville CT business. Higher degrees are not typical,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are available in such specialties as salon or spa management. Whatever type of program you decide on, it’s imperative to make sure that it’s certified by the Connecticut Board of Cosmetology. Numerous states only approve schools that are accredited by certain reputable agencies, including the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Online Cosmetology Classes

Taftville CT student attending online beauty schoolOnline beauty programs are convenient for Taftville CT students who are employed full-time and have family obligations that make it hard to enroll in a more traditional school. There are many web-based cosmetology school programs available that can be attended by means of a personal computer or laptop at the student’s convenience. More conventional cosmetology programs are often fast paced due to the fact that many programs are as brief as 6 or 8 months. This means that a considerable portion of time is spent in the classroom. With internet courses, you are covering the same amount of material, but you are not spending numerous hours away from your home or driving back and forth from classes. However, it’s essential that the program you choose can provide internship training in local salons and parlors in order that you also get the hands-on training necessary for a comprehensive education. Without the internship part of the training, it’s difficult to gain the skills required to work in any facet of the cosmetology field. So be sure if you choose to enroll in an online program to confirm that internship training is provided in your area.

Is the Program Accredited? It’s necessary to make certain that the cosmetology school you pick is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education recognized local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Programs accredited by the NACCAS must measure up to their high standards guaranteeing a superior curriculum and education. Accreditation may also be essential for obtaining student loans or financial aid, which often are not offered in 06380 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a requirement for licensing in some states that the training be accredited. And as a final benefit, numerous Taftville CT businesses will not hire rec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more positively upon individuals with accredited training.

    Taftville, Connecticut

    Taftville is a small village in eastern Connecticut. It is a neighborhood of Norwich but has its own post office (ZIP Code 06380). It was established in 1866 as site for the large Taftville Mill, later Ponemah Mill. The village is listed on the National Register of Historic Places as Taftville and as alternative name Taftville/Ponemah Mill National Register Historic District.

    Currently redevelopment of the large mill is being conducted by The O'Neill Group in conjunction with OneKey LLC. The National Park Service will oversee the historic preservation of the structure, to ensure the historic elements are sustained. The 430,000-square-foot (40,000 m2) Ponemah Mill is being converted into luxury apartments and commercial space.[2]

    The Ponemah Mills, a cotton textile factory, was built on the Shetucket River where a large dam could be built to provide power. The large mill building (Building No. 1) was purported to be the largest weave-shed under one roof at that time. The original workers were predominantly Irish immigrants, and they were hard hit by the depression of the 1870s that began with the Panic of 1873. Unemployment rose and wages dropped appreciably from 1873 to 1875, causing bitter relations between workers and management in many places.[3]
